Income in West Ulverstone

What people and households earn each week, and how incomes are spread.

A gap of $687 separates the typical weekly household income in West Ulverstone from the national figure. This area is among the lowest for earnings in the region, with typical weekly family incomes sitting well below both the state and national averages.

Typical incomes

Median personal, family and household incomes.

Typical weekly household income is $1,059, which is far below the Australian figure of $1,746. Weekly personal income is also well below the national figure at $541, though this has risen by $125 since 2011.

Income spread

High earners and the full distribution.

High earners are much less common here than in most areas, with only 9% of households earning $3,000 or more a week. This is far below the 22.6% seen across Australia, although the proportion of high-earning households has risen by 5.9 percentage points since 2011.

In West Ulverstone, the largest group is $650–$1,499 at 39%, followed by $1,500–$2,999 (26%) and Under $650 (25%).

In West Ulverstone, Under $650 is the majority at 57%; $650–$1,499 is next at 30%.
